Spacecraft Design Engineer (30%): As a Spacecraft Design Engineer, you will be responsible for designing, developing, and testing spacecraft systems and subsystems. Your expertise in robotics will help create advanced spacecraft with cutting-edge technology. 2. Navigation Systems Engineer (25%): Navigation Systems Engineers work on the design, development, and implementation of navigation and control systems for spacecraft. Robotics skills are valuable for improving the autonomy and efficiency of these systems. 3. Robotics Software Engineer (20%): Robotics Software Engineers develop software for robotic systems used in space environments. This role requires a deep understanding of robotics, programming languages, and software development methodologies. 4. Aerospace Research Engineer (15%): Aerospace Research Engineers work on innovative projects to advance the field of space exploration. Robotics skills can help develop new robotic systems and improve existing ones, making them more versatile and efficient. 5. Mission Operations Engineer (10%): Mission Operations Engineers manage and monitor spacecraft missions, ensuring their success. Robotics skills can help create autonomous systems and facilitate real-time decision-making during missions.
